Navigating the World of NDIS Providers

The National Disability Insurance Scheme (NDIS) offers assistance to individuals with disabilities. One key aspect of the NDIS is the diverse range of providers who deliver programs. Choosing the right provider can greatly impact your outcomes.

This resource aims to assist you with understanding the world of NDIS providers.

First, it's essential to determine your individual needs and goals. What kinds of support are you looking for? Once you have a clear understanding of your requirements, you can begin researching providers who focus on those supports.

Utilize the NDIS portal to find registered providers in your region. You can narrow down your inquiry based on criteria such as service coverage, specialization, client reviews.

Avoid hesitating to inquire multiple providers to discuss your needs and gather more information. Arrange meetings or discussions to understand their philosophy and confirm they are a suitable fit for you.

Remember, choosing the right NDIS provider is a individual decision. Take your time, investigate thoroughly, and select a provider who values your goals.
